NEWS– The Uganda Traffic Police in have confirmed the death of 6 people who died on spot in Kamuli District and 8 others were seriously injured in accident that took place at Nawantumbi Trading centre along Kamuli – Jinja road.

Busoga North Regional Spokesperson Kasadha Micheal told journalists today afternoon that the Police have instituted investigations following the fatal accident.

Kasadha said that the incident involved supercustom motor vehicle registration number UAZ742U, which was part of the Kyabazinga Royal team from Kamuli heading to Jinja.

Kasadha said that it’s alleged that, the motor vehicle which was part of the Kyabazinga royal wedding team convoy lost control and rammed into road side bystanders who viewing the procession killing 6 on spot.

The bodies of the dead were taken to Kamuli General Hospital Mortuary for postmortem examination, and the injured victims were also taken to different health facilities for treatment.

The Police Spokesman Fred Enanga described the accident as unfortunate and blamed it on overspeeding and the illfated motor vehicle is parked at Kamuli District Central Police Station station pending inspection by the Police Inspector of Vehicles.
